They are listed herePlayers from Linwood University, where Mark Wilson coached, won the collegiate championship the last six years it was held. Landon Shuffett won it two years in a row for Linwood University. But, it looks like the big stick played a decade earlier: Lars Vardaman won it three years in a row for Southern Illinois University–Edwardsville. Wow!
